TV Series “Rose and Layla” Begins Production

Production began on Yousra and Nelly Karim's new TV series “Rose and Layla”.

Karim announced Monday on Instagram stories that the news along with sharing a photo of the clapperboard.

 

The series also features Karim's husband Hisham Ashour and rising actor Tayam Amar.

The project witnesses Karim and Ashour's first acting project.

Ashour is set to play the role of Rose’s husband and a detective who takes on cases and helps her in the investigations.

The series consists of 12 episodes and is set to debut on the "Shahid VIP" streaming platform.

“Rose and Layla” was written by British author and screenwriter Chris Cole and directed by British filmmaker Adrian Shergold.

The series is a blend of genres that range from black comedy, action, suspense, and adventure.

“Rose and Layla” is centered around two investigators who are hired to stop a major bank fraud from happening.

The series marks the second collaboration between the actresses after the 2014 TV series “Saraya Abdeen”.

Yousra was last seen in the comedy series “Ahlam Saeed” while Karim last appeared in the series “Faten Amal Harby”.

On the other hand, Yousra is making a comeback to the stage after 20 years of absence.

She is starring in a new play entitled “Zyara el Set el Agoz” (“The Old Lady’s Visit).

The play is based on an international play written by Swiss author and dramatist Friedrich Dürrenmatt and will debut in the Riyadh season.

Yousra made her last stage appearance in the 2002 play “Lama Baba Yanam” (After Dad Sleeps).
